Rudolf Maister nicknamed Vojanov. The Slovene Division General, commander of Maribor in the Slovene army, also a poet and self-taught painter.

Born on March 29th 1874 in Kamnik, Slovenia (Austro-Hungary back then), active in the period from 1890 to 1923. He died on July 26th julija 1934, in Rakek, Slovenia (Yugoslavia at that time). The recipient of numerous military decorations, such as Signum laudis, the order of the white eagle, the order of the star of Karađorđević and the order of Saint Sava.
